using System;
using System.Web.Mail;
public class FancyMailTest
{
public static void Main()
{
MailMessage mm = new MailMessage();
mm.From = "[email protected]";
mm.To = "[email protected];[email protected]";
mm.Cc = "[email protected];[email protected]";
mm.Bcc = "[email protected];[email protected]";
mm.Subject = "This is a fancy test message";
mm.Headers.Add("Reply-To", "[email protected]");
mm.Headers.Add("Comments", "This is a test HTML message");
mm.Priority = MailPriority.High;
mm.BodyFormat = MailFormat.Html;
mm.Body = "<html><body><h1>This is a test message</h1><h2>This message should have HTML-type formatting</h2>Please use an HTML-capable viewer.";
try
{
SmtpMail.Send(mm);
} catch (System.Web.HttpException)
{
Console.WriteLine("This device is unable to send Internet messages");
}
}
}
